Japan

Despite being recognized as one the the originators of gaming, Japan currently languishes in 12th place in overall eSports earnings, having made $37,730,642.94 from 3,638 players.

The top earning game for Japanese eSports players is PlayerUnknown's Battlegrounds which has a 15.37% share of the earnings.

UK

The UK finds itself one place above the Japanese in 11th place, with its 5,245 players earning $45,480,561.15. Fortnite is the game of choice for British players, who have made $8,281,681.86 from it so far.

The British eSports Federation is the national body for competitive gaming and was created in 2016. This has resulted in some of the top eSports tournaments coming to the UK and there are teams set up around the UK as its infrastructure continues to improve.

While the majority of the money has been made by fortnight players, the country's love of soccer has seen players like Donovan ‘Tekkz’ Hunt, Tom ‘Stokes’ Stokes, and Spencer ‘Gorilla’ Ealing make waves in FIFA competitions.

United States

The U.S. boasts the largest amount of eSports players, with 27,624 competitors earning $279,280,291.20. This puts the country in second place behind China, with Fortnite accounting for 17.51% of the country's winnings.

25 American eSports players have now earned over $1 million, with Kyle "Bugha" Giersdorf making the most with earnings of $3,720,091.72. Saahil "UNiVeRsE" Arora and Peter "ppd" Dager are the only other American gamers to exceed earnings of over $3 million.

Giersdorf's achievements are all the more remarkable when you consider is just 21 with over $3 million of his earnings coming in Fortnite tournaments in 2019 when he was just 16.

China

China's record earnings of $303,559,238.82 have been earned by 8,923 players with Dota 2 being the most popular game, accounting for $85,378,116.07 (28.13%) of their total.

China's success is down to an impressive infrastructure that came despite early opposition from the Chinese government. Now, the country is home to dedicated arenas and their best performer has earnings of over $4 million.

Chunyu ‘Ame’ Wang's $4,205,904.27 was earned in 78 Dota 2 tournaments and he has been playing since 2015.

South Korea

South Korea has the third highest earnings and is the only country outside of the U.S. and China to exceed $100 million. Their 5,828 players have made $148,193,554.66, with just over a quarter of that coming from League of Legends.

South Korea is widely regarded as the forerunner of eSports, having invested in the industry for more than a decade. Its top players are regarded as top celebrities in the country, much like pop and movie stars.
